In the trailer for Baz Luhrmann‘s new movie The Great Gatsby, which features Kanye West and Jay-Z‘s No Church In The Wild, there’s a quick shot of a pretty heroic spelling error.

During the 1:42 mark, there’s a flash of New York’s very own Times Square in the 1900’s with a brightly lit Billboard that displays “Zeigfeld Follies.” The only problem is, it’s spelled wrong!

The variety show that ran on Broadway from 1907 to 1931 is correctly spelled “Ziegfeld Follies.”
Although it’s a minor mistake, some people dished their feelings on twitter, tweeting:
“A budget of $127,000,000 and it seems no one was paid to check the spelling of “Ziegfeld Follies” in the Great Gatsby trailer. #whoopsadaisy”
